[Talk-de] Gemeindegrenzen DE
gmbo
gmbo at kilometerfresser.eu
Fr Jul 14 06:34:10 UTC 2023
Am 13.07.23 um 21:00 schrieb Markus:
> Hi Gisbert,
>
> Danke für die Infos und den Turbo-Lin :-)
>
> Am 13.07.2023 um 15:39 schrieb gmbo:
>
>> mit overpass turbo damit kannst du die Relationen Amtlicher
>> Gemeindeschlüssel abfragen.
>> Mit MapCSS kannst du markieren.
>> http://overpass-turbo.eu/s/1xmn
>
> Wenn ich den Code richtig verstehe, macht der zuerst den DE-Unricc und
> fragt dann die drei Beispielorte ab?
> und liefert dann die 4 Geenzpolygone
> a) auf der Turbo-Karte?
> b) als GeoJSON unter "Daten"?
> und b) könnte man dann für Leaflet verwenden?
Der code fragt alle Relationen ab die den Key amtlicher
Gemeindeschlussel hat.
Man könnte bestimmt auch auf den DE Umriss verzichten, da der Key ja ein
rein deutscher also de:amtlicher_gemeindeschluessel ist.
Aber das Ergebnis wäre das selbe.
> Bei mir rödelt er etwas und fragt, ob ich 300 MB runterladen wolle?
> Anschliessend zentriert er auf Hamburg, zeigt aber nur die Basiskarte.
> (keine blauen Polygone)
>
> Wo liegt mein Fehler?
Auch bei mir rödelt der lange, deshalb habe ich den Timeout hochgesetzt.
Die Zeit es dauert bis die alle Polygone erst mal dargestellt sind. Ich
gehe auch davon aus dass es gut wäre wenn man die reduzieren kann, aber
das sind alle Punkte mit denen OSM die Polygone beschreibt. selbst wenn
er die Polygone zeigt kommt noch immer wieder die Meldung, diese Seite
verlangsamt Firefox. Halten Sie die Seite an....,
Wenn ich das lange genug ignoriere kann zum Beispiel zoomen und dann
versuchen zu exportieren (ging gerade nicht.). Ist wohl besser die Daten
der Polygone direkt aus der Overpass-Api abzufragen um sie zu bekommen,
oder (area.a) durch ({{bbox}}) ersetzen um mit kleinen Ausschnitten zu
testen.
> 300 MB wären für Leaflet vermutlich zu gross?
> Wobei ~10.773 Gemeinden sind ja schon eine Nummer...
> Ein reduziertes Grenzpolygon mit 0,001 bei osm-boundaries.com
> ist zwischen 1 kB (Diefeld) und 8 kB (Berlin), DE hat 115 kB.
Wie man die Polygone reduziert bekommt weiß ich leider auch nicht.
Wie gesagt, sollte ja nur ein erster machbarer Ansatz sein. Normal würde
n solche Abfragen ja nur ab einer bestimmten Zoomstufe zugelassen, aber
deine Beschreibung mit der universellen Einstellmöglichkeit und
gleichzeitig der Anzeige aller verlangt nach den vielen Daten.
>> Wie du das MapCSS on the fly verändern kannst kann ich so nicht
>> sagen. > Aber das ganze sollte ja auch nicht pausenlos über Overpass
>> geholt
>> werden. Also einmal exportiert.
>
> Ja, nur 1x runterladen, danach via Leaflet als Themenkarte verteilen.
> Dort kann man ja das CSS beliebig gestalten.
Hatte ich gehofft, dass es dafür eine Lösung gibt. (Würde mich auch
interessieren wie es geht.)
Gruß
Gisbert
>
> Gruss, Markus
>
>
>>> Am 13.07.23 um 10:13 schrieb Markus:
>>
>>> Gibt es irgendwo alle Gemeindegrenzen von Deutschland in einer (1)
>>> Datei
>>> zusammengefasst als GeoJSON?
>>> Und zwar so, dass man jede einzelne adressieren kann, beispielsweise
>>> mit
>>> den Gemeindeschlüssel (AGS).
>>>
>>> Die adressieren Gemeinden sollen per Code ausgewählt und deren Fläche
>>> eingefärbt werden.
>>>
>>> Beispiel:
>>> Zeige auf der Karte:
>>> AGS=01058157 (Strande)
>>> AGS=02000000 (Stadt Hamburg)
>>> AGS=03256 (Landkreis Nienburg/Weser)
>>> als hellblaue Fläche
>>> uns alle anderen Gemeinden mit einer dünnen dunkelblauen Grenzlinie
>>>
>>> Wo finde ich sowas?
>>>
>>> Mit herzlichem Gruss,
>>> Markus
>>>
>>> Beispiel von Wikipedia:
>>> https://commons.wikimedia.org/wiki/File:Germany_(%2Bdistricts_%2Bmunicipalities)_location_map_current.svg
>>>
>>>
>>> Die Grenzpolygone sollten generalisiert sein,
>>> vergleichbar mit "Very little (0,001)" bei https://osm-boundaries.com/
>>>
>>>
>>> _______________________________________________
>>> Talk-de mailing list
>>> Talk-de at openstreetmap.org
>>> https://lists.openstreetmap.org/listinfo/talk-de
>>
>>
>>
>> _______________________________________________
>> Talk-de mailing list
>> Talk-de at openstreetmap.org
>> https://lists.openstreetmap.org/listinfo/talk-de
>
>
> _______________________________________________
> Talk-de mailing list
> Talk-de at openstreetmap.org
> https://lists.openstreetmap.org/listinfo/talk-de
Mehr Informationen über die Mailingliste Talk-de